Burbot, Ling and Blue Ling - Unique Scandinavian Eel-like Fish Lithograph
This stunning 19th-century lithograph from *Skandinaviens Fiskar* features three captivating eel-like fish species from Scandinavian waters: the Burbot (Lota lota), the Ling (Molva molva), and the Blue Ling (Molva dypterygia). Illustrated with scientific accuracy and artistic mastery by Wilhelm von Wright and C. Erdmann, and published by P. A. Norstedt & Söners Förlag in Stockholm, this plate beautifully captures the sinuous elegance and distinct characteristics of these elongated fish.
At the top of the print, the Burbot (Lota lota) is depicted with its characteristic serpentine body and ornate mottling of dark brown and yellow patterns. The texture of the fish’s smooth, slippery skin is masterfully rendered, capturing its natural sheen and vibrant hues. A distinct chin barbel gives the Burbot an almost catfish-like appearance. Known as the only freshwater member of the cod family, Burbots inhabit cold rivers and lakes throughout Scandinavia. They are particularly valued for their firm, flavorful flesh and are often sought by ice fishermen during winter months.
In the center of the composition lies the Ling (Molva molva), a long and robust fish with a subtly tapering body and prominent lateral line. The brownish-yellow coloration is interspersed with irregular light patches, giving it a marbled appearance. The graceful curvature of the body and the pronounced fins highlight its elongated form. Ling are known for their deep-sea habitats and are prized as a food fish, especially valued in Scandinavian and northern European cuisine.
At the bottom of the print is the Blue Ling (Molva dypterygia), which shares a similar elongated form but exhibits a smoother and more uniformly colored body, with subtle shading that transitions from a pale underbelly to a darker back. The elongated dorsal and anal fins run almost the entire length of the body, giving it an eel-like appearance. Blue Ling are typically found at great depths and are known for their mild, delicate flesh.
The lithographic technique used in this print combines fine line work with carefully applied hand coloring, creating lifelike depictions that blend scientific precision with artistic beauty. Each fish is rendered with an exceptional eye for detail, capturing both their unique anatomy and natural coloration.
